A Transport that communicates on a connected TCP socket.
When persistency is set to permanent, whenever the TCP connection is severed, the transport state is set to DOWN, and the connection is retried periodically with exponential backoff until it is reestablished

Request the transport to be closed.
This operation is effective only if transport is in UP or DOWN state, otherwise it has no effect. The transport changes state to CLOSING, and performs cleanup procedure. The state will be changed to CLOSED when cleanup is complete, which may happen synchronously or asynchronously.

performs Transport specific operations to close the transport
This is invoked once by close()
after changing state to CLOSING. It will not be invoked by Transport class if the transport is already CLOSING or CLOSED.
When the cleanup procedure is complete, this method should change state to CLOSED. This transition can happen synchronously or asynchronously.

This size is the maximum packet size that can be sent or received through this transport.
For a datagram-based transport, this is typically the Maximum Transmission Unit (MTU), after the overhead of headers introduced by the transport has been accounted for. For a stream-based transport, this is typically unlimited (MTU_UNLIMITED).

set transport state
Only the following transitions are valid: UP->DOWN, DOWN->UP, UP/DOWN->CLOSING/FAILED, CLOSING/FAILED->CLOSED

total incoming bytes
This counter includes headers imposed by NFD (such as NDNLP), but excludes overhead of underlying protocol (such as IP header). For a datagram-based transport, an incoming packet that cannot be parsed as TLV would not be counted.

total outgoing bytes
This counter includes headers imposed by NFD (such as NDNLP), but excludes overhead of underlying protocol (such as IP header). This counter is increased only if transport is UP.
